HTC One M9 name spotted on HTC’s website

HTC’s latest One flagship has been one of the worst kept secrets in the mobile world recently, and now the company itself has contributed to the rumor mill. Mobile blog TechTastic has noticed that there are several references to the One M9 in HTC’s own website HTML code. The references seemingly confirm the existence of the device and the name under which it will be sold and marketed.

For most, the HTC One M9 name seemed to be a given, but there was some still doubt regarding whether or not the company would continue with M# naming scheme. The original HTC One was known only internally as the M7, with the company never using the M# name scheme with the public.

The HTC One M9 is rumored to pack a 5-inch display with a 20.7-megapixel rear camera and a 13-megapixel front-facing camera. Other specs include a Snapdragon 810 processor, 3GB of RAM, and a 2,840 mAh battery.

The HTC One M9 is expected to be unveiled on March 1st at Mobile World Congress in Barcelona. We’ll have full coverage of the week’s events.
